Additional tariffs will be imposed on solar imports from Cambodia, Malaysia, Thailand and Vietnam after the U.S. International Trade Commission voted that the domestic solar industry is materially injured by them, the ITC announced Tuesday. Utility Dive
A U.S. District Court judge in Washington, D.C., has granted a preliminary injunction against the Department of Defense and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th for not following a Biden-era executive order mandating the use of project labor agreements on some federal jobs. Construction Dive

'One Big Beautiful Bill' Passes House – Key Tax Changes
The House of Representatives passed H.R. 1, officially named the “One Big Beautiful Bill Act,” a sweeping tax reform package that extends and expands key provisions from the 2017 Tax Cuts and Jobs Act (TCJA) while introducing expanded tax breaks and other new measures. The bill now moves to the Senate for its consideration.

NECA Endorses Action to Eliminate Barriers for NY Contractors
NECA strongly supports the introduction of the Infrastructure Expansion Act by Congressman Nick Langworthy (NY-23), a crucial piece of legislation that would modernize liability laws on federally funded construction projects in New York.
